From 011fa5d63126c7184f6ff98765b26ce258407df7 Mon Sep 17 00:00:00 2001 From: jihor Date: Mon, 26 Jun 2017 19:18:20 +0300 Subject: [PATCH] Add option to control management registration, switch AutoServiceRegistrationProperties to use Lombok --- .../AutoServiceRegistrationProperties.java | 15 ++++++++------- 1 file changed, 8 insertions(+), 7 deletions(-) diff --git a/spring-cloud-commons/src/main/java/org/springframework/cloud/client/serviceregistry/AutoServiceRegistrationProperties.java b/spring-cloud-commons/src/main/java/org/springframework/cloud/client/serviceregistry/AutoServiceRegistrationProperties.java index d489afe8..87a29adb 100644 --- a/spring-cloud-commons/src/main/java/org/springframework/cloud/client/serviceregistry/AutoServiceRegistrationProperties.java +++ b/spring-cloud-commons/src/main/java/org/springframework/cloud/client/serviceregistry/AutoServiceRegistrationProperties.java @@ -2,23 +2,24 @@ package org.springframework.cloud.client.serviceregistry; import org.springframework.boot.context.properties.ConfigurationProperties; +import lombok.Getter; +import lombok.Setter; + /** * @author Spencer Gibb */ @ConfigurationProperties("spring.cloud.service-registry.auto-registration") +@Getter +@Setter public class AutoServiceRegistrationProperties { /** If Auto-Service Registration is enabled, default to true. */ private boolean enabled = true; + /** Whether to register the management as a service, defaults to true */ + private boolean registerManagement = true; + /** Should startup fail if there is no AutoServiceRegistration, default to false. */ private boolean failFast = false; - public boolean isFailFast() { - return failFast; - } - - public void setFailFast(boolean failFast) { - this.failFast = failFast; - } }